How we calculate it
We divide Forbes' $300,000,000 total 2026 earnings evenly across the year: 365 days × 24 hours × 3,600 seconds = 31,536,000 seconds, giving ~$9.51 per second. It blends on-field pay and off-field endorsements, so it is an average, not a paycheck.
For context
A 90-minute match takes roughly 5,400 seconds — about $51,400 at that rate. He passes the median annual US household income roughly every ninety minutes of elapsed time, every day of the year.
